Solution
1. (R), 2. (S), 3. (Q), 4. (P)
Explanation:
| Column I | Column II |
| 1. Factors of production | R. Economic resources |
| 2. Land | S. Natural resources |
| 3. Capital | Q. Man-made resources |
| 4. Entrepreneur | P. Human resources |
